Venetian masks

Perhaps the most famous symbol of Venice is the carnival mask. Masks can be found everywhere - in souvenir shops and street ruins, in art galleries and special workshops. After all, the Venice Carnival is perhaps the most famous and “popular” in Europe.

The simplest and cheapest masks are made of clay or gypsum - they are very attractive and perfect as souvenirs. If you wish, you can paint a ceramic mask yourself - in many shops they offer sets for decorative painting.

Lighter and more elegant papier-mâché masks decorated with rhinestones and feathers are much more expensive. Papier-mâché products are quite fragile and delicate, which creates some difficulties during transportation.

Finally, the most expensive and unique masks, reminiscent of the one worn by the famous Giacomo Casanova, going on feats, are made of genuine leather. You can’t buy such a mask on the street or in a souvenir shop - you can find them only in art galleries or antique shops.

Murano glass

As you know, the famous island of glassblowers Murano is territorially related to the Venetian lagoon, so every self-respecting tourist considers it his duty to bring some trinket from Murano glass from Venice.

Murano glass products are real works of art - amazingly beautiful, elegant, unique, they can be presented both as a souvenir and as an exclusive gift for any celebration.

Amazing glass products - utensils, chandeliers, vases, various decorations, figurines can be bought both in workshops on the island itself, where these unusual little things are blown directly in front of customers, and in numerous souvenir shops in Venice.

If you want to buy real Murano glass, be sure to pay attention to the brand on the product, in addition, the weight of Venetian glass is noticeably heavier than usual.

Cosmetics from Venice

Do not know, what to bring from Venice for ladies you know? Take a look at one of the shops where handmade cosmetics are sold, and without buying, you certainly won’t leave there - the aromas are fabulous.

Hand made soap is especially popular - vanilla, chocolate, flower, sold by weight - right at the customers’s place it is cut with a knife from a large piece resembling a cheese head. In addition to soap in cosmetic shops, you will find freshly prepared lotions, creams, masks, balms in charming jars that are not ashamed to present as a gift.
